Big Firkin Saturday (10/2)
Don’t forget, this Saturday (tomorrow) at 2pm we’ll be tapping our next cask (firkin) of real ale for growler fills!  This time we have a unique specialty from Terrapin: Cherry Oak Big Hoppy Monster!  The base beer, Big Hoppy Monster, is an 8.3% ABV imperial red with massive hop flavor that scores a nearly perfect 99 rating on Ratebeer.com.  This one off special cask version was aged on cherry oak for a true once in a .  These one off casks are always a blast and a tricked out version of one our all time favorites is sure to be a hit!

If you have never been to one of our special releases before, it is beer in it’s purest form: conditioned in the cask and free of force carbonation, filtration or other processing.  Real cask ales allow the beer to showcase different nuances of texture, flavor and aroma than their normally kegged counterparts.  Unlike our regular growler fills, is highly perishable and must be consumed the same day so plan accordingly!  We will gravity tap this cask on the counter at 2pm and growler fills of this beauty will be limited so don’t wait.

Rare Beer Tuesday Tonight at 5pm (5/5)
As we do every Tuesday at 5pm, we’ll be tapping a very special, highly limited keg for fills.  Tonight’s feature is a beer called Confluence from Brewing in Portland, Maine.  Confluence is created with a mixed fermentation of two yeast strains, undergoes a lengthy aging process and is dry hopped prior to bottling.  This all translates to a very complex and unique beer.  This will be the only draft release of this beer in South Carolina.  Don’t miss it!
